I've just been persuading my husband the benefits of weekly meal planning, and the past week has gone really well. So I thought I'd record ours here - would love to see others too!

Sunday - shopping day. Lamb steaks, cauliflower cheese, "bubble'n'squeak" potato cakes.
Monday - Fast day for me - ready meal chicken arabiata for dinner/ grilled chicken with boiled potaotes and beans
Tuesday - salad lunch, dinner Fragrant pork, aubergine and pak choi.
Wednesday - lunch leftover pork, dinner Tom Kerridge's sausage and bean casserole
Thursday - fast day for me so red veg and lentil soup, leftover casserole for him.
Friday - leftovers for lunch, baked chicken thighs, potato wedges and gorgonzola sauce for dinner.
Saturday - squid, chorizo and couscous
